示例#1
0
 /// <summary>
 /// Utworzenie obiektu "EwidencjaSrodkowPienieznych"
 /// (wskazuje symbol ewidencji, do której zostaną skierowane raportu)
 /// </summary>
 private static EwidencjaSrodkowPienieznych ReadEsp(CommaReader commaReader, ExampleFormatReaderInfo info)
 {
     return(new EwidencjaSrodkowPienieznych
     {
         ReaderInfo = info,
         Symbol = commaReader.ReadString()
     });
 }
示例#2
0
 /// <summary>
 /// Utworzenie obiektu "Kontrahent"
 /// (w enova będą tworzeni lub aktualizowani kontrahenci)
 /// </summary>
 private static Kontrahent ReadKontrahent(CommaReader commaReader, IReaderInfo info)
 {
     return(new Kontrahent
     {
         ReaderInfo = info,
         Kod = commaReader.ReadString(),
         Nazwa = commaReader.ReadString(),
         Nip = String.Empty
     });
 }
示例#3
0
 /// <summary>
 /// Utworzenie obiektu "RaportEsp"
 /// (w enova powstanie obiekt raportu)
 /// </summary>
 private static RaportEsp ReadRaportEsp(CommaReader commaReader, ExampleFormatReaderInfo info)
 {
     return(new RaportEsp
     {
         ReaderInfo = info,
         Definicja = commaReader.ReadString(),
         Data = commaReader.ReadDate(),
         Numer = commaReader.ReadString()
     });
 }
示例#4
0
        /// <summary>
        /// Uzupełnienie właściwości obiektu "Zaplata"
        /// (w enova powstaną wpłaty i wypłaty w założonym wcześniej raporcie ESP)
        /// </summary>
        private static Zaplata ReadZaplata(CommaReader commaReader, Zaplata zaplata)
        {
            zaplata.Numer           = String.Empty;
            zaplata.Data            = commaReader.ReadDate();
            zaplata.PodmiotKod      = commaReader.ReadString();
            zaplata.SposobPlatnosci = commaReader.ReadString();
            zaplata.Kwota           = commaReader.ReadDecimal();
            zaplata.KwotaWaluta     = commaReader.ReadString();
            zaplata.ZaplataZa       = commaReader.ReadString();
            zaplata.Opis            = commaReader.ReadString();

            return(zaplata);
        }